If a figure with a number of ciphers attached to it be divided by 9, the quotient will be composed of that figure only repeated as many times as there are ciphers in the dividend; with the same figure as the remainder.
| Example: | 9 | ) 7000000 |
| ———— | ||
| 777777 - 7 |
EXCUSES.
“Miss Brown,—You must stop teach my Lizzie fisical torture. She needs reading and figgers more an that. If I want her to do jumpin I kin make her jump.”
“Please let Willie home at 3 o’clock. I take him out for a little pleasure, to see his father’s grave.”
“Dear Teecher,—Please excuse John for staying home—he had the meesels to oblige his father.”
